We are currently searching for a Scientific Program Manager to provide support to the National Institutes of Health (NIH). This opportunity is a part-time position with MSC and is fully remote, supporting groups in Liberia, and Bethesda, MD.

 

 

Duties & Responsibilities
  • Provide support to the Partnership for Research on Vaccines and Infectious Diseases in Liberia (PREVAIL) Operations Director and the laboratory Lead.
  • Work with the PREVAIL Assistant Director for Laboratory Services to harmonize clinical and research laboratory activities; to assist with building biorepository capacity across NIH DCR special projects.
  • Develop career enrichment opportunities for PREVAIL clinical and research scientists.
  • Work with the Research Sustainability Initiative in Liberia (RETAIN) to build partnerships with the United States Agency for International Development (USAID), Fogarty International, academic institutions, and other partners conducting scientific research in Liberia to provide coordination to ensure synergy among research projects and collaborations.
  • Assist with the preparation and review of training materials, protocols, and information summaries as needed.
  • Assist with preparation and submission of manuscripts.

 

Requirements
  • Bachelor’s degree in addition to at least ten (10) years of relevant research laboratory experience is required.
  • Candidate must have at least five (5) years of experience working in low resource overseas research laboratories and at least five years of experience working in a clinical setting.
  • Experience supporting clinical trials and studies for infectious diseases research is required.
  • Demonstrated experience in developing successful international partnerships, working with Ministries of Health, and national laboratories is preferred.
  • Experience in the conduct and analysis of clinical diagnostic, molecular, immunologic, and virologic assays is preferred. Minimum of three (3) years of management experience is preferred.

Company Description

Dovel Technologies and its Family of Companies (Medical Science & Computing and Ace Info Solutions) were acquired in October 2021.

 

Guidehouse is a leading global provider of consulting services to the public sector and commercial markets, with broad capabilities in management, technology, and risk consulting. By combining our public and private sector expertise, we help clients address their most complex challenges and navigate significant regulatory pressures focusing on transformational change, business resiliency, and technology-driven innovation. Across a range of advisory, consulting, outsourcing, and digital services, we create scalable, innovative solutions that help our clients outwit complexity and position them for future growth and success. The company has more than 12,000 professionals in over 50 locations globally. Guidehouse is a Veritas Capital portfolio company, led by seasoned professionals with proven and diverse expertise in traditional and emerging technologies, markets, and agenda-setting issues driving national and global economies.
